Palworld‘s Next Update Promises a Massive Expansion, But Will It fix the Game’s Bugs?
The highly anticipated survival game Palworld is gearing up for its biggest update yet, promising a massive new island and a host of gameplay improvements.Though, after a recent patch caused widespread issues, some players are wondering if the developers can deliver on their promises while also addressing the game’s lingering bugs.
Palworld,which blends Pokémon-like creature collecting with a gritty survival setting,has garnered significant attention since its early access release. Players can capture and train Pals, fantastical creatures that assist in everything from combat to resource gathering.
The upcoming update, slated for next month, is six times larger than the game’s last major patch, according to the developers.It will introduce a new island described as the “largest and harshest” environment yet, presenting players with fresh challenges and opportunities.
This news comes on the heels of a controversial update that introduced several game-breaking bugs, leading to widespread frustration among players. Some even blamed Nintendo, mistakenly believing the company was involved in the game’s development.
While the developers have since released a patch addressing some of the issues, concerns remain about the game’s stability.
“The new island sounds amazing, but I’m hesitant to get my hopes up,” saeid one player on social media. “I just hope they’ve actually fixed the bugs this time.”
The success of Palworld’s next update hinges on the developers’ ability to deliver on both fronts: expanding the game’s content while ensuring a smooth and enjoyable experience for players. Only time will tell if they can rise to the challenge.
